PatchGate checks whether a GitHub pull request has the issue link, CI evidence, code owners, and human approval a repository requires before a maintainer reviews it.
That is the job. PatchGate does not review code, detect AI authorship, or decide whether a change should merge.
The evaluator is deterministic and produces a receipt that explains which requirements passed, which evidence is missing, and which human gate remains. It cannot force external automation to stop working.

policy. validate and local-file preflight read an explicit path. Git-ref
preflight reads patchgate.yml and the discovery-only guidance files from
the named commit using Git objects; it does not checkout or execute
pull-request code. doctor reports local capability without requiring a
token. All discovery findings are advisory, needs-confirmation, or
unsupported and can never become enforcement by themselves.
The evaluate command consumes a normalized JSON snapshot so that policy
evaluation can be tested without network access. The GitHub adapter
produces this snapshot from recorded authenticated metadata and
base-revision content. Live mode is explicit, requires
PATCHGATE_GITHUB_TOKEN, and is documented in
the adapter contract.
PatchGate uses three separate lanes:
- The trusted metadata lane reads base-revision policy, GitHub metadata, rulesets, CODEOWNERS, reviews, and commit-bound check evidence. It never checks out or executes pull-request code.
- The untrusted verification lane may run contributor code in a separate read-only workflow with no repository secrets.
- The decision lane evaluates authenticated metadata and explicitly bound evidence, then emits a receipt.
For GitHub Actions, a pull_request_target workflow may read metadata and post
results, but must never execute a checkout of pull-request code. A workflow
that needs to run contributor code belongs in the unprivileged
pull_request lane. See the architecture note and
the threat model.

PatchGate can report ready_for_review, blocked,
human_review_required, evidence_missing, or policy_ambiguous. A status
check blocks a merge only when a maintainer configures the corresponding
GitHub rule or ruleset. human_review_required means that a declared human
gate remains unsatisfied; it is not proof that a human has reviewed the code.
PatchGate must not claim a cryptographic signature, tamper-proof receipt, compliance certification, or proof that the code is correct until the exact mechanism and verification path exist and are tested.
- Maintainers of public repositories who spend review time on pull requests that arrive without the policy, evidence, or ownership signals the repo requires.
- Teams whose coding agents open pull requests faster than humans can triage.
- Not a fit if you want authorship detection, correctness scoring, or blocking without configuring a GitHub rule to honor the status check.
